Here is Coventry's typical weather in each month: the average daytime high and overnight low in °C, how each month feels, and the wettest month marked. Use it to plan any trip to Coventry by season.
Coventry runs from warm summers, with August highs near 21°C, to cold winters, when January lows sit around 2°C (a swing of about 19°C across the year). July is usually the wettest month, and Coventry sees roughly 958 mm of precipitation annually.
The most comfortable time to visit Coventry is usually May, June, August and September, when daytime highs sit in the pleasant 16-26°C range and the heaviest July rain is behind you.

The models often agree on temperature and still split on rain — and rain is usually what decides whether a plan survives. A wide rain range means the shower is genuinely uncertain, not that the forecast is wrong.
